Unfortunately COBRA ends when an employer shuts down its health care program (bankruptcy, etc.)


Wait, what? That is insane policy.


It is logical, in that it is "employee allowed to continue on group insurance from employer when leaving company". If the employer shuts down or shuts down the insurance, there's nothing to continue.
